Travis Rutz fundraiser on Sunday
Friday, October 23, 2009 | 10:20 am
That's a signed Kasey Kahne helmet, one of the items that will be auctioned off this Sunday to help raise money for Travis Rutz, a Canadian sprint car driver who was injured in a racing accident in Indiana.
The "Slide Job City" Travis Rutz Fundraiser will be held Sunday at the Masonic Temple Crystal Lodge in Marysville, Wash.
The silent auction is from 1-5 p.m. and the live auction goes from 5-7:30 p.m. Items on the block include T-shirts, sweatshirts, posters, cards and decals -- include the signed side of a Tony Stewart No. 20 Home Depot car -- and drivers will be present for autographs.
There will also be a beer garden open all day.
